Generally speaking, this strategy can be the starting point for major price moves, expansions in volatility, and when managed properly, can offer limited downside risk. A breakout is a price moving outside a defined support or resistance level with increased volume.

A support level is where a share price has shown a tendency to bounce back after falling and the resistance level is where the price has shown a tendency to rebound towards the downside after the price has risen. Here, a breakout trader will enter a long position on an index after the price breaks above resistance or enters a short position after the price breaks below support. Technical Indicators in Indices Trading Technical index trading involves reviewing charts and making decisions based on patterns and indicators.

These patterns are particular shapes that candlesticks form on a chart , and they can give you information about where the price is likely to go next. There are 4 major types of indicators: Trend indicators show you which direction the market is moving in. Momentum indicators show you how strong the trend is and can also tell you if a potential short-term reversal is going to occur.

Waning momentum suggests that the market is becoming exhausted and may be due for a retracement or reversal. An accelerating momentum condition suggests that the trend is strong and likely to continue. The three primary trading signals that can be generated with the momentum indicator include the Line Cross, the Momentum Crossover, and the Divergence signal. Volume indicators show you the volume of trading in a certain index and its change over time.

This is beneficial because when the price changes, volume levels can give an indication of how strong the next move may be. Bullish moves on high volume are more likely to be maintained than those on low volume. Volatility indicators show you how much the price is changing over a given period.

As we all know, volatility is a fundamental factor in the market, and without it, there would be no profits. But remember- volatility tells you nothing about future direction, just the range of prices. Position Trading Indices Position trading generally involves buying and holding an index for a longer period of time. This can be for several days, weeks, or even longer. As a result, a position trader is less concerned with short-term market fluctuations. Position traders will make far fewer trades than day traders, with each trade carrying a greater potential for profit.

Through a stock index CFD, you are also able to go long and short on the index. The price of the stock indices CFD reflects the underlying index prices. Depending on the forex broker that you trade with, these stock index CFD prices can differ slightly. This is because the forex broker also adds a mark up on the bid and ask prices. When you trade a stock index CFD, you do not own the underlying stocks and neither do you own the underlying index. You can only speculate and thus make a profit or loss from the stock index CFD.

Stock indices on MT4 behave like normal instruments such as forex. Firstly, these stock indices are available for trading 5 days a week.

Depending on the index you choose, you may or may not be able to place a trade. This is true if the stock index belongs to a region. You can find more details of the trading hours by right-clicking on the symbol and selecting properties. This specifications window will show you the trading hours for that index in question.

A major difference with trading stock indices on MT4 is obviously leverage. And with leverage, you have additional factors to bear in mind. Swap fees or rollover fees matter when trading indices on MT4 The most important of all is the swap or the overnight financing costs.

No matter whether you are long or short, you will have to pay an overnight swap fee. Seasoned forex traders will know that especially on Wednesdays, you have a triple rollover. The triple rollover ensures to account for weekends as well. Hence, if your trading strategy is to hold the trade for a few days, then these overnight swap fees can eat into your profits.

The swap fees are denoted in points. The points indicate the total fees you will pay for trading one standard lot. Dividend payouts on stock indices in MT4 Interestingly, if you have a long position on a stock index, around the dividend payout periods, these are added or credited to your account.

Of course, if you happen to have a short position, the dividend amounts are debited from your account. You can think of this as an additional cost of trading indices on MT4. Depending on the stock index you trade, the dividends may vary. While dividends are a completely different story, we will only mention that if you are long on the stock index, and if that index pays out dividends, then you get those dividends as well. To check if a stock index pays dividends or not, you should visit the respective stock index factsheet to learn more.

Thus, if you have a long position around the Dividend Pay Date, then you get paid this amount. Index trading for beginners As a beginner, if you are interested to trade stock indices on MT4, then you need to first understand the basics of these indices. Unlike forex, where there are quite some similarities between the currency pairs, with stock indices on MT4, it is different.

Each stock index tends to have its own characteristics. Factors such as dividend payments, quarterly futures expiration and so on play a big role in influencing the price of the stock index. Thus, it is in your best interest to understand the basics of the stock indices before you even start trading them.

Once you have the basics in place, the next step is to pick a liquid index. You can choose any of the major US stock indices as these are the most liquid. Paper trading or demo trading on these stock indices can help you to get familiar with the price action. This is when you can start applying your technical trading strategies or even start using custom charts. Since you can go long and short trading stock indices on MT4, there can be a temptation.

Risk management is essential when it comes to trading stock indices on MT4. Due to the tick value, if you choose an inappropriate lot size, you can end up losing all your capital. This leads us to another aspect. As a beginner, before you trade stock indices, get to know the details such as the tick size, tick value and so on.
